In Their Name: The Call for a Wrongful Death Act in BC - January 2008
CANF, the Trial Lawyers Association of BC and BC Coalition of People with Disabilities (BCCPD) are seeking a new wrongful death act in British Columbia. In Their Name is a BCCPD report on this issue. A new act is needed to enable family members, who suffer the loss of a loved one due to the harmful actions of others, to obtain a full measure of justice. The first part of the report documents the stories of four families. The second looks at the Family Compensation Act from the community's perspective and offers a proposal for a new wrongful death act in British Columbia.
